Louisiana Legislature · HB 430 · Signed by the Governor - Act 643

LAW ENFORCE/OFFICERS: Enacts the MJ 911 Act to extend health insurance coverage for families of law enforcement officers and firemen employed by the City of Lafayette who are killed in the line of duty (EN INCREASE LF EX
